Summary: | The number of weblogs related to conservation has increased rapidly over the past few years, and are a popular tool for dissemination of conservation-related information, and raising public interest in the preservation of cultural heritage. Some student blogs are integrated into university courses on conservation, and this paper presents three such examples, illustrating how blogs can be used as a teaching and learning support tool. |
